WebOct 19, 2024 · The first piano was invented in the early 1700s by Bartolomeo Cristofori, an Italian instrument maker. Cristofori’s piano was different from the modern piano in that it had a softer sound and was easier to play. In a number of ways, the piano is an important part of instrumental music. WebIt is not known exactly when Cristofori first built a piano. An inventory made by his employers, the Medici family, indicates the existence of a piano by the year 1700. An expert harpsichord maker by trade, his invention was a hammer mechanism … WebIn 1709, Bartolomeo di Francesco Cristofori presented the first version of the piano to the public in Florence. This early version of the piano, named gravicembalo col piano e forte, allowed musicians to create varying degrees of volume. Pianos today are still pretty similar in look and design to the one Cristofori invented in 1709.
